Quick context for the Lumenquist release: autocomplete got slow because the Fenwick index rebuild was running synchronously on each deploy. We moved the rebuild to the Ashgrove worker pool, which pulls jobs from the queue using an authenticated connection. Before cutting the release, make sure the worker's env file contains this line:

env line for fafof-fahag: LEDGER_TOKEN5=f8790

## Step 4: Slim the Runtime Image

After the Larkbuild base swap, the Ternfeed service image drops from 1.4 GB to 210 MB. Strip the debug toolchain, keep only the runtime deps listed in the manifest, and rebuild with the multi-stage target. Verify startup probes still pass before promoting. The slimmed image reads its settings from the environment, and the values it expects at boot are listed below.

deployment values, faduf-tawep:
SORDOR_LOG_LEVEL=error
SORDOR_METRICS_HOST=metrics.sordor.nelvrolabs.internal
SORDOR_POOL_SIZE=4

Runbook fragment — weekly cash-box run, Merrow Depot. Every Friday at 07:30 the sealed cash boxes from the trade counter are staged in the caged area beside dock 2. The shift lead verifies seal numbers against the manifest and signs the transfer sheet. Boxes travel with Ashgrove Secure Transit only; no substitutions. Once the vehicle is confirmed, the shift lead carries out the hand-over instruction stated below.

dispatch memo: the quenvan holax courier leaves the zoreth briath kasvan ledger at gate 7481 under passcode 618862

Team,

Effective Monday, Hallowick Analytics caps discounts on deals above 500k at 15%, with CFO approval mandatory beyond 10%. Finance flagged that Q3 large-deal margins slipped four points, mostly from uncontrolled end-of-quarter concessions. Deal Desk will publish the approval matrix tomorrow. No verbal approvals — everything logged in Tradepoint. Sales comp will be adjusted to reward margin, not just bookings. Push back on exceptions hard. The rationale ties directly to next year's plan, summarized below.

— Priya, VP Finance

internal memo for kawip-hadug: Headcount on the Wenwyn team goes from 7 to 140 by the end of January. Gross margin on Wenwyn came in at 20 percent against a plan of 15 percent.